Transaction 30659d24fdc29a609f9ea2afc260c53c24e677f1be7e261ae6b3c6da4d856042
1 Input
1 Output
-
30659d24fdc29a609f9ea2afc260c53c24e677f1be7e261ae6b3c6da4d856042:0
- value
- 18860952
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d4b9e565d7e0d2106f6261cfe1ae353083043fd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MB6vThjEVLgztrXJLrUJe49T4s4V8ZcXD